Sightseeing spot in Niigata

Getting There - city bus or train Attractions - lake, birds, seasonal flowers Food & Restaurants - dinning inside the plaza near the lake Entrance fee - free Niigata lake is famous for it’s seasonal events and bird sightseeing. In summer, there is tons of lotus blooming, the bird sightseeing season will be starting from middle to late April. White bird types - small and big white bird The amount of bird - around 8,000 birds Feeding to birds - not allowed Area - about 260 ha #niigata #japan
